Agentic Context Management: Solving Agent Memory and Cost by Treating Them as Lifecycle and Architecture Problems
Summary
The arXiv preprint introduces Agentic Context Management (ACM) as a lifecycle and architecture problem for production AI agents, addressing how context memory and costs are managed. It outlines five primitives for ACM and argues that proper context compaction yields linear token costs with preserved fidelity, plus a reference implementation Maximem Synap and future benchmarking areas.
